Congratulations to our 2021 ChildServe Champions: Principal® and Margo and Don Blumenthal. This annual award celebrates donors who advance ChildServe’s mission through generosity, service and inspiring others to action.

Principal

As one of ChildServe’s top 10 cumulative donors, Principal has built an exceptional relationship with ChildServe in the following ways:

  • Principal has contributed more than $1 million in cumulative gifts since 1989.
  • In ChildServe’s recently completed Forward Together campaign, Principal provided a $500,000 lead gift which will support a new state-of-the-art pediatric rehabilitation unit.
  • Principal has sponsored ChildServe’s signature event, the Bubble Ball, since its inception in 2011.
  • Support from Principal has helped ChildServe to expand programs and services, as well as purchase crucial therapy equipment.

“Helping people is an important part of our culture at Principal. That’s why the company, its employees and the Principal Financial Group Foundation, Inc., work together to give back in the communities where our employees live and work,” said Jo Christine Miles, director of community relations for Principal.

Margo’s passionate board service has been instrumental in ChildServe’s expansion of services and connection to the community. In addition, Margo and Don have made a significant impact in the following ways:

  • Margo and Don played an instrumental role in launching ChildServe’s Respite program, which serves more than 600 children and families across the state of Iowa.
  • They have donated more than $400,000 in support of ChildServe’s mission since 1991.
  • Margo and Don have sponsored ChildServe’s signature event, the Bubble Ball, since its inception in 2011.
  • They are members of ChildServe’s Legacy Society, and have included a gift in their will to make a lasting impact."

“We are honored to receive this prestigious award from an organization near and dear to our hearts,” said Margo and Don. “We know helping families with resources to care for their children with special healthcare needs helps to make our community a great place to live. We made our living here, and we want to give back here—and ChildServe is one of our top causes.”
